Ghanaian youngster Enock Otoo found the back of the net on Wednesday, April 23, scoring the opener in Levadia’s clash against Paide in Round 9 of the Estonian Meistriliiga.
The talented winger started the game and played the full 90 minutes, making a strong impact from the flanks. In the 32nd minute, Otoo received a well-placed pass from teammate Michael Schjonning-Larsen and finished it off with a well-taken strike to give Levadia a first-half lead.
Despite going into the break with the advantage, Levadia couldn’t hold on in the second half. Paide came back strongly, with Robi Saarma and Muhammed Suso scoring to complete a 2-1 comeback win for the home side.
Otoo’s goal takes his tally for the season to three goals and three assists in nine appearances, continuing to show his quality and growing influence in Levadia’s attack.
